Why Knowing Your Tank's Litre Capacity Matters
Before diving into the mathematics, it deserves understanding why exact water volume is so critical. An aquarium is a closed community, and preserving chemical balance is vital.
- Medication Dosing: Overdosing can toxin fish, while underdosing leaves illness untreated. Practically all Aquarium Gallon Size Calculator medications need accurate measurements based on litres.
- Water Treatments: Dechlorinators, fertilizers, and pH adjusters must be included precise percentages to the volume of water being treated.
- Equipping Limits: The traditional guideline-- such as one centimetre of fish per litre of water-- depends totally on knowing the true water volume.
- Filtering Requirements: Filters are rated by the volume of water they can process per hour. Knowing the tank size ensures adequate purification.
Basic Formulas for Standard Tank Shapes
The method utilized to determine litres depends on the shape of the aquarium. A lot of tanks fall under a few standard geometric classifications.
To make computations simple, the universal conversion factor to keep in mind is:1 cubic centimetre (₤ cm ^ 3 ₤) = 0.001 litres (or 1,000 cubic centimetres = 1 litre).
Alternatively, when determining in centimetres, the standard formula for rectangular tanks is:₤ ₤ text Volume in Litres = frac text Length (cm) times text Width (cm) times text Height (cm) 1,000 ₤ ₤
1. Rectangular Aquariums
Rectangular tanks are the most typical type discovered in homes. To discover the volume, determine the interior length, width, and height in centimetres.
- Formula: ₤ text Length times text Width times text Height/ 1,000 ₤
- Example: A tank determining 100 cm long, 40 cm wide, and 50 cm high:₤ ₤ frac 100 times 40 times 50 1,000 = frac 200,000 1,000 = 200 text Litres ₤ ₤
2. Round (Round) Aquariums
Cylindrical tanks need a somewhat different formula since of their circular base, relying on pi (₤ pi approx 3.1416 ₤).
- Formula: ₤ pi times text Radius ^ 2 times text Height/ 1,000 ₤ ( Note: Radius is half of the size).
- Example: A cylinder with a size of 50 cm (Radius = 25 cm) and a height of 60 cm:₤ ₤ 3.1416 times 25 ^ 2 times 60/ 1,000 = 3.1416 times 625 times 60/ 1,000 = 117.8 text Litres ₤ ₤
3. Bow-Front Aquariums
Bow-front tanks feature a curved front glass that broadens the viewing location. Due to the fact that calculating the precise volume of the bow can be intricate, aquarists generally utilize a customized rectangular formula.
- Method: Measure the width from the side (at the narrowest point) and the width at the widest point of the bow. Typical the two widths together, then treat the tank as a standard rectangular shape.

One common mistake newbies make is presuming that a 200-litre tank holds 200 litres of water. In reality, it holds less. This inconsistency is because of displacement.
Every object put inside the aquarium presses water out of the way. For that reason, the actual water volume is lower than the calculated glass volume. Aspects that reduce overall water volume consist of:
- Substrate: Gravel, sand, or aqusoil layers use up considerable space at the bottom of the tank.
- Hardscape: Large driftwood pieces, rocks, and slate formations displace water.
- Decors: Artificial ornaments, caves, and background structures minimize capability.
- Equipment: Internal filters, heaters, and air stones take in minor amounts of area.
- Unfilled Space: Most tanks are not filled right to the very leading; water sits a centimetre or more below the plastic rim.
How to Estimate Displacement
While calculating the specific displacement of every rock and pebble bores, aquarists can usually approximate that decors, substrate, and void lower total tank volume by approximately 10% to 15%.
For instance, a tank determined geometrically to hold 200 litres will likely hold closer to 175 to 180 litres of actual water as soon as totally decorated. When dosing powerful medications, it is always much safer to determine based upon this somewhat minimized water volume to prevent unexpected overdosing.
Step-by-Step Guide: How to Calculate Your Tank's Volume
Follow these basic steps to discover the real water capacity Weight Of Aquarium Calculator any basic aquarium:
- Measure the Interior: Use a tape measure to find the inside length, width, and height of the glass. Determining the inside avoids factoring in the thickness of the glass walls.
- Transform Units: Ensure all measurements are in centimetres.
- Use the Formula: Multiply Length ₤ times ₤ Width ₤ times ₤ Height, then divide the resulting number by 1,000 to get litres.
- Deduct for Substrate and Decor: Estimate the space taken up by gravel and rocks, and subtract approximately 10% from the final number to find the real water volume.
- Alternative Method (The Bucket Test): For irregularly shaped or custom tanks, the most precise way to find volume is to fill the tank utilizing a container of a recognized size (such as a 10-litre pail) and keep a tally of how lots of containers it requires to fill the aquarium.
